About the team Your mission In this role, you will drive the hardware function forward — from electronics to mechanical and structural design - building reliable, scalable and mission-ready UAV systems. You will own hardware architecture decisions, schematic design, PCB development, and system-level electronic integration for mission-critical embedded systems. This is a highly technical individual contributor role focused on deep engineering expertise, independent decision-making, and solving complex hardware challenges in demanding environments. Responsibilities Design complex multilayer PCBs and embedded electronic systems for advanced drone and aerospace platforms Develop schematics and PCB layouts in Altium Designer Own hardware bring-up, debugging, validation, and production readiness Define robust power, signal integrity, grounding, and thermal architectures Collaborate across embedded, mechanical, systems, and manufacturing teams Drive technical decisions in fast-paced, mission-critical development environments Qualifications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Electrical Engineering, Electronics Engineering, Embedded Systems, Mechatronics, Aerospace Engineering, or a related field 5+ years of hardware/electronic design experience Strong multilayer PCB, high-speed digital, and mixed-signal design expertise Advanced Altium Designer experience Strong debugging and validation skills using lab equipment Experience in aerospace, defense, robotics, automotive, or other safety-critical industries Ability to independently lead hardware development from concept to production Nice to have Experience with ruggedized, airborne, or mission-critical electronic systems Exposure to embedded systems, STM32 platforms, or hardware-software integration Familiarity with DFM, DFT, and manufacturing-oriented hardware development practices Experience with RF systems, secure communications, or telemetry electronics German language skills for collaboration with customers and procurement stakeholders About us SECURITY CLEARANCE Due to the nature of our work in the defence sector, candidates must be eligible to obtain and maintain the appropriate security clearance required for this position.
